SELL OREGON, IS ADVICE
ADVERTISING EXPERT AD
DRESSES IiCXCIIEON'.
Thomas Iu Emory Tells Portland
to Emulate Example Set
by California.
That there is no more real live
advertising possibility than the
proper selling of Oregon was the
declaration of Thomas Ij. Emory, ex
Portlander and now Pacific coast
manager of the bureau of advertis
ing for the American Newspaper
Publishers' association, in an ad
dress at the luncheon of the Ad
club at the Benson hotel yesterday
.noon.
"It is high time that Oregon's
business men began to use a few
colorful adjectives in speaking of
their communities," he said. "Refer
to the glorious, unexcelled Colum
bia River highway, the green-clad,
heavily timbered hills that sur
round the most beautiful city In tne
world Portland. Your drinking
water; you can use a number of ad
jectives in talking about that."
Mr. Emory told of the booster
spirit which seemed to animate the
people of California and declared
that the Oregonians could well use
the same tactics in pushing the
state to the front.
"When you are away from Port
land, don't simply say you are from-j
Portland, Or., or Salem, Or., or some
other town in the state," he .said.
"Do as the Califorians do. Tou are
from the glorious, sun-kissed, God
blessed state of Oregon."
Mr. Emory also declared that this
state must compete with the $10,
1)00.000 annual commercial and com
munity advertising of California.
Wasting of Estate Charged.
EUGENE, Or., Sept. 20. (Special.)
Alleging that her father's widow,
Mrs. Aneta Wilson, is wasting his
estate and that no accounting is
being made as required by law. Ha
zel Lawson, daughter of Daniel Wil
son, who died in j-Eugene May 21,
1321, leaving an estate'. valued at
$30,115, yesterday filed a petition in
probate court here asking that the
administratrix be removed.
Tigard Fair Dated.
TIGARD, Or., Sept. 20. (Special.)
The date for the Tijrard grange,
school and community fair has been
set for October 21. The fair will
bo held at the school, using. the old
buildings for the agricultural ex
hibits. Special invitations are being
sent to neighboring communites to
enter with exhibits, and a fine pre
mium list is bplng- prepared.
